Career path

Career Role (Bioconversion Development) Description
Bioprocess Engineer Develop and optimize bioconversion processes, ensuring efficient and sustainable production of biofuels and biomaterials. High demand in the UK's green energy sector.
Biochemist (Bioconversion Focus) Research and develop novel biocatalytic pathways for improved bioconversion efficiency. Crucial for advancements in sustainable chemistry and biotechnology.
Bioreactor Specialist Design, operate, and maintain bioreactors used in large-scale bioconversion processes. Expertise in bioreactor engineering and process optimization is essential.
Metabolic Engineer Modify microbial metabolic pathways to enhance production yields in bioconversion. Cutting-edge role in developing sustainable bio-based products.
Bioconversion Scientist Conduct research and development across various aspects of bioconversion, leading to innovative solutions in biofuel, biomaterial, and biochemical production.
